For our client - a leading company in the printing industry, we are looking for: Operator of Introducing Machines Location: Inowrocław Tasks:
  • Operation of introducing machines
  • Preparation of materials and components necessary during introducing processes
  • Packaging of finished production and preparation for dispatch
  • Reporting
  • Preparation of a sheet or finished product for subsequent processing and finishing
  • Replacing parts, setting up the device, regulating and ongoing maintenance of introducing machines
  • Organizing one's own and team work
  • Controlling the quality of work performed and controlling finished products
  • Maintaining order and cleanliness at the workplace
Requirements:
  • Availability for shift work (6:00-14:00, 14:00-22:00, 22:00-6:00)
  • Vocational education minimum (preferably medium-level vocational training)
  • Techincal skills and manual dexterity
  • Experience in production work (preferably in the printing industry)
  • Ability to work in a team
Benefits:
  • Form of employment - assignment agreement - with the possibility of transitioning to a temporary employment agreement after a trial period
  • Remuneration - PLN 30.50/hour brutto for daytime hours; PLN 36.50/hour brutto for nighttime hours
  • Full job training
  • Work from Monday to Friday
